Indonesia is ranked as the most highly polluted country in Southeast Asia and the 26th on the list of the most polluted countries worldwide. Exercising in polluted spaces can have complex effects on inflammation and mitochondrial biogenesis in the lungs. The interaction between physical activity and pollution exposure may affect lung health. This study aimed to analyse the different effects of exercise in polluted open spaces and antioxidant administration on lung inflammation and mitochondrial biogenesis. The research approach used was a quantitative approach with a comparative descriptive design using random assignment technique. The research sample used male white rats (Rattus Norvegicus) Wistar strain aged 8-10 weeks with a body weight of 200-300 g obtained from Biofarma Animal Breeding Facility. The sampling technique used in this study was random assignment technique. In this study, the number of members of the treatment group was 5, so the total research sample amounted to 5 x 9, namely 45 samples. The results showed that there was a differentiation in the level of inflammation represented by the level of IL-6 and NF-κB and lung mitochondrial biogenesis level represented by PGC-1α, TOM20, and COX IV with moringa administration in physical activities, as indicated by the comparison of the mean values of the inflammatory process and lung mitochondrial biogenesis in the nine treatment groups. The implication of this research is that it is necessary to consider appropriate sport strategies or guidelines for individuals who exercise in a polluted environment to reduce the negative impact on the respiratory system and overall lung health.

Volleyball matches can be very long, especially if the two teams are evenly matched. Physical endurance is essential to maintain high performance during matches that may last up to five sets. Athletes who have good endurance can continue to move, jump, and perform fast movements throughout the game without experiencing excessive fatigue. Tabata training and circuit training are two types of training that focus on improving physical fitness with different methods, such as training duration and training format. The aim of this study was to examine the effect of tabata training and circuit training on increasing the endurance of volleyball athletes. In this research, researchers applied an experimental method with a pre-test post-test control group design. The research samples consisted of 30 athletes from the Tectona club in Cianjur Regency. The instrument for measuring the endurance of volleyball athletes was the yoyo test. Samples were receiving treatments 3 times a week with a total of 18 meetings. Hypothesis testing used paired sample-test and independent sample-test analysis. The research results showed that both tabata training and circuit training had an effective influence in increasing endurance of volleyball athletes, but the circuit training showed a more effective result compared to the tabata training. The study concludes that both of the training models have positive effects on increasing endurance of volleyball athletes, but the circuit training model has a more effective influence on increasing endurance.

Changes and implementations of the new curriculum require a careful preparation and information about the Independent Curriculum, known as Kurikulum Merdeka. The learning model used needs to be explored as an illustration of teacher understanding. This study aimed to examine teacher perspectives regarding their understanding of the Kurikulum Merdeka and the Sport Education Learning Model. The cross-sectional survey method was used to collect data. Data were collected using Google Form filled by 74 teachers. The research instrument was in a Likert scale form and consisted of 30 questions focused on exploring teacher understanding of the Kurikulum Merdeka, the Sport Education (SEM) Learning Model, the SEM Phases/Syntax, and the roles existing in the implementation of the SEM Model and the importance of understanding curriculum and learning models in school. Then, 15 open-ended questions related to models often used by teachers, training expectations to follow, and obstacles experienced during learning at school were given. The research data were processed using Winsteps 5.2.3 software. The Rasch Model analysis was used to analyze the instruments made and the results of the teacher understanding perspective. The results showed that the instrument was valid for use. Related to the results of the teacher perspective, 48.6% of physical education teachers had an understanding and belief in the importance of the Kurikulum Merdeka and the SEM model in elementary schools at a high level. Meanwhile, 12. 2% were at the moderate level and 39.2% were at the low level. These findings can be used as a reflection related to the teacher understanding of the Kurikulum Merdeka and the Sport Education Learning Model and as a reference in arranging training needed for Physical Education teachers in the field.

Social skill is one of the life skills that must be possessed by students. Students who have good social skills can interact with their peers and show a positive attitude in both school and social settings. Role-playing learning model is considered as a model that can develop social skills. However, there is no empirical evidence that role-playing learning model in physical education can develop student social skills. Therefore, this study was aimed to examine the effect of role-playing model in physical education on student social skills. This study used an experimental method with One Group Pre-Test Post-Test Design. This study involved 30 sixth grade students of public elementary schools in one of school in West Java. The instrument used was a social skill questionnaire compiled by the researcher. The test used to test the hypothesis of this study was the paired sample t-test using SPSS version 25 with a signification level of α=0.05. The results of this study showed that there was an effect of role-playing model on student social skills. This study concludes that the use of role-playing model in physical education has a positive impact on student social skills. This model is able to play a strategic role as an educational tool, especially for teaching social skills.

This study was aimed to determine how gamma waves and motor educability correlate to gymnastics movement performance of West Java gymnastic athletes. The study used quantitative descriptive method with a correlational design. The population and sample of this study were 13 West Java gymnastic youth athletes selected using saturated sampling technique. The instruments used were gymnastic performance tests, motor educability test (IOWA Brace test), and brain wave test using the Emotiv EPOC Wireless helmet. Based on data processing and analysis, the correlation value between gamma brain waves and movement performance was r= -0.620 with a p -value 0.024 0.05, while the coefficient of determination was 0.384, meaning that there was a contribution of 38.4%. It concludes that, there was a negative functional correlation between gamma brain waves and movement performance. The obtained correlational value between motor educability and gymnastic performance was r = 0.646 with a p-value 0.017 0.05 and a coefficient of determination of 0.418, showing that there was a contribution of 41.8%. It implies that that there was a positive functional correlation between motor educability and gymnastic performance. The correlation value of gymnastic performance, gamma brain waves, and motor educability was r = 0.749 with a p-value 0.016 0.05 and coefficient of determination of 0.560, indicating that gymnastic performance was determined by gamma brain waves and motor educability of 56.0%. The results showed that there was a strong correlation and a significant contribution of gamma waves and motor educability to movement performance in gymnastics.

Obesity is considered a global health problem that has reached epidemic proportions and significantly affects almost all physiological functions of the body. Swimming can reduce fat levels so that it can reduce obesity conditions which can trigger other cases. However, training that exceeds capacity can cause skeletal muscle damage. This study aims to determine the effect of swimming of various intensities (light, moderate and heavy) on creatine kinase (CK) activity and the histopathological appearance of the musculus vastus lateralis in obese rats (Rattus norvegicus). This study used a true experimental using a Completely Randomized Design (CRD) posttest-only control group design approach. The sample in this research; white rat (Rattus norvegicus) male Wistar strain, body weight 150-200 grams, and aged 6-8 weeks. Obesity induction; Pokphand 551, BOLT, cassavas and carrots. The rats were divided into 5 groups and each group consisted of 4 rats. Swimming is given once per day every morning for 14 days. CK activity was measured using UV-Vis spectrophotometer and histopathological preparations of the musculus vastus lateralis using Hematoxyline Eosine (HE) staining. Swimming significantly (p 0.05) reduced CK activity. The best results were found in group 4 with a reduction of 37.29% from obese controls, and an increase of 11.53% from healthy controls. The best CK activity values were obtained by the group that had values closest to those of healthy controls. The histopathology results of group 4 showed histopathological improvement based on reduced inflammatory infiltration, fiber profile abnormalities and the presence of myofiber hypertrophy as a form of cell adaptation. Group 4 (obesity + moderate intensity swimming) is the best treatment to reduce CK activity and improve the histopathology of the musculus vatsus lateralis.

Football players should be in good physical condition to support their performance on the pitch. For example, the cardiorespiratory capacity (VO2 max) needed to maintain endurance during the game. An increase in VO2 max indicates the ability of the heart and lungs to function optimally during exercise. Low endurance can cause football players to tire easily. Exercises that can be done to increase VO2 max are circuit training and interval training. Circuit training has a physiological effect on the muscles. They adapt and are automatically able to increase the maximum oxygen volume. Interval training has an effect on the metabolic waste produced by the muscles during rest, which increases oxygen consumption during exercise and increases VO2 max. The aim of this study was to determine the difference in the effect of circuit training and interval training on increasing VO2 max in football players. For the research method, an experimental method was used with a quasi-experimental approach to pre and post test two grub design treatment, the sampling technique used total sampling, a sample of 44 people with a 3x a week training programme for 6 weeks. The research instrument used was the multi-stage fitness test and the data analysis used was the paired samples t-test. Results showed that there was an effect of circuit and interval training on increasing VO2max in footballers (P=0.00 P0.05), with a more significant effect in the circuit group.

The goals of this study is to determine is there a contribution between self-confidence and anxiety on the performance of gymnastic athletes. The population in this study were 105 West Java gymnast athletes. The sample in this study used a random sampling technique, the sample was taken 20% of the population. The instruments used are self-confidence tests (Andrianto, 2016), anxiety (Competitive State Axienty Inventory-2) and gymnastic performance tests (code of points). Analysis of the research data used descriptive statistical analysis techniques and tested the hypothesis by processing data using the statistical product for social science (SPSS) 26 program. The results obtained were: (1) A correlation of r = 0.592 was found with a p-value of 0.005, and a contribution of 35 %. That way there is a significant positive contribution between self-confidence and gymnastic performance. (2) The correlation value is r = -0.597 with a p-value of 0.004 and contributes 35.7%. Thus there is a significant negative contribution between anxiety and exercise performance. (3) The correlation value is 0.663 with a p-value of 0.005 and contributes 44%. That way there is a significant positive contribution between self-confidence and anxiety on gymnastic performance.

Distribution of triple jump phases was deemed as a technical factor because the phase ratio significantly affects the actual distance in the triple jump. The objective of this study was to identify the phase ratio that is a measure of effort distribution in the triple jump. Hop-dominant, balanced, and jump-dominant techniques were three triple jump techniques defined based on phase ratio which are compared with its of world triple jumpers. The descriptive method was used in this research and subjects were male Indonesian triple jump athletes whose films were taken to be analyzed using Dartfish motion analysis. The percentage analysis obtained from each phase was calculated by comparing it with the total distance of the jump. The largest percentage value of the three phases was the type of jump performed. The performance of the world's triple jumpers was used as a comparative model for analysis to assess the quality of the movement and each athlete's movement sequence form was compared with movement of world triple jumper. The data revealed that the ratio of hop, step, and jump phases was 32% :30% :38%. The phase ratio of Indonesian triple jumper that produced the greatest jump distance was achieved in the jump phase. Despite phase ratio of each subject was wildly different but it was a good index detector of perfect distribution phase that demonstrates the good practice model especially for Indonesia triple jumper athletes.
